### 2024-11-07 — Key rotation for export retry service

Rotated signing credentials for Ferrowork's export-retry worker after the old pair expired. Failed exports queued during the rotation window were replayed automatically; no data loss. New team members: the retry worker signs each re-submitted batch before handoff to the archive tier, so verification failures usually mean a stale key on your machine. Update your local config with the new key and re-run any stuck batches. Current key:

rollout seal: bky4_yke3

// MIGRATION NOTE — hermetic build cutover (Project Calderwood)
//
// This constant pins the toolchain digest used by the new hermetic
// build system. Do NOT bump it casually: the legacy Makefile path and
// the hermetic path must produce byte-identical binaries until the
// cutover completes, and this pin is what keeps them aligned. If the
// on-call sees divergent checksums in the parity job, revert this file
// first, then page build-infra. The last verified parity build is
// recorded directly below.

pipeline stamp: htk9_b3279b371

## ORM Refactor Notes

The legacy Quillbase ORM layer is being replaced by Strandline adapters. Migration scripts live in `db/strand/`. Do not cut a release while table shims are active. Verification runs against the Ledgerfox staging service before each tag. The pipeline needs the staging service key exported as an env var. Here it is:

service key, kaduf-bawig: kto15_Ze79S0dligTw0yO

**Q: How long does the Taxlume rate cache persist?** Lookups are cached for 24 hours per jurisdiction. Plugins must not cache rates locally; always call the Taxlume endpoint. To force a refresh during testing, flush via the sandbox console. Flushing production requires the break-glass flow, which prompts for the recovery passphrase shown below.

vault phrase of tajeg-tageg = pelix-druix-holius-briael-zorwyn-frawyn-fraox-norok-drueth-aldiel

**Q: How do I generate realistic records with Stubforge?**

Stubforge is our test-data factory library. Import the factory for your model, override only the fields your test cares about, and let defaults handle the rest. Don't hardcode fixtures — factories keep schemas in sync automatically. Recipes live in the shared examples folder. For help, contact the tooling crew.

escalation mailbox, yajeg-bageg: quenax.olidor@lumiccorp.internal